AT SEA JANUARY 15

Well, it finally happened. No sun today, instead fog, fog, fog. But no problem, because we were too far out to sea to see shore anyway. So, I went to the Celebrity Guest Chef event with Tim Byres. Great demo and lecture. Then I washed my clothes in the self service laundry. After lunch I observed, didn’t participate, but observed the foxtrot dancing lesson.

Then nap time! I read a couple of chapters of Killing Kennedy and fell asleep. Got up, decided to shave and put on my tuxedo shirt and bow tie with my black suit. Went to happy hour, then dinner and finally the Black & White Ball. Lots of fun to observe people having fun.

No port tomorrow, but we will pass by the Amalia Glacier and Canal Sarmiento. International Beer Tastating 1:00; Cellar Master’s Premium Wine Tasting at 2:00: and dinner at Le Cirque at 8:00. Tough life.
